New 'Optical Biopsy' could give surgeons instant answers during operations
NCT ID NCT04154683
Summary
This study is testing a new imaging device called Cellvizio® that allows surgeons to see tissue at a cellular level in real-time during gynecological surgeries. The goal is to see if this 'optical biopsy' can accurately identify abnormal tissue—like tumors or endometriosis—without needing to remove a physical sample for lab analysis. Researchers will compare the device's readings to traditional lab results from 80 women undergoing various gynecological procedures.
